Are there any Arcadia 2001 A/V output mods?


Recommended Posts

From a PM from akaviolence...

 

I pulled comp video at the junction of R40, R42, and R22. Also, removed R43, R41, and R51.

The last one powers the RF modulator, the first two helped with brightness etc.

I also used a 220uF cap in line with the comp video

 

 

Personally, I haven't removed the resistors yet, and haven't added the capacitor. The reason that I have a Leisurevision, and there's no silk screen. As a result, at the moment, I have a dark picture. I also haven't hooked up audio yet.
